Are your lights on a 12/12 schedule? Do you have may light leaks in your space? But from the last picture you put up it does look like its putting on new vegetative growth rather than new flowers.
Exactly! That new growth really made me start wondering... As sad as it is I do have a light leak.... but it's just the sun literally piercing through the thickest mylar I could buy. Guess I will double it. #Smoking Gun

How long do they take to be put back into flower?
 
Smoking Gun

Smoking Gun

2,235
263
That is a pretty intense light leak for that much new vegetative growth to be showing. You may want to consider switching the mylar to a black and white poly. Or put something definitively more opaque behind the mylar. As for how long until they go back to flower, I can't really say; it may be a while as that new vegetative growth is pretty big and strong looking. Regardless, you will more than likely have a reduced yield at this point; that is a lot of stress on the plant.

Make sure your all of your electrical equipment in the grow space is LED free or covered by multiple layers of duct tape if they do have them. Check power cords, surge protectors, cameras, fans, dehumidifier, etc. Good luck!! 👍🏼

What do you mean by LED?
 
Brotofsky

Brotofsky

492
93
Power lights on electrical devices. I had a Wyze cam in my grow space only to discover a LED light glow around the camera. I didn’t experience re-veg, but did have nanners. Thankfully they turned out sterile (no pollen).
